Output 6ae5e3fa7632d3e3c9cfd30f6b9fe6340655e23dea155ca63a4e80abac747ee2:3

value
42351993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5ef9dfadfee0437bb804bc4142add897674b8a OP_EQUAL
address
MQytNMa2i4sAKKBSzfmsKiaXAzJzLdmTyq
transaction
6ae5e3fa7632d3e3c9cfd30f6b9fe6340655e23dea155ca63a4e80abac747ee2
spent
true